Agastache, also known as Mexican Giant Hyssop (Agastache mexicana), is a remarkable perennial plant that is sure to captivate any garden enthusiast. Its charming stems, reaching a height of 60-80 cm, and its spiky flower clusters not only add an aesthetic touch to flower beds and meadows but also attract bees, bumblebees, and butterflies. The delicate aroma of mint and anise wafting around this plant creates an incredibly pleasant atmosphere in the garden. Mexican Giant Hyssop is an excellent choice for cut flowers, allowing you to enjoy its beauty indoors as well. This plant combines aesthetics with practicality, enhancing any garden it graces.

Sowing

When planning to sow Agastache, keep in mind that it thrives best in slightly loose soil. Seeds can be sown under cover, providing them with optimal conditions for germination. Ensure the soil is adequately moist to help the seeds begin their gardening journey healthily and swiftly.

Sowing Depth

Place Agastache seeds at a depth of 0.5 cm. This depth ensures that the seeds have access to essential nutrients and the right amount of light, fostering their proper development.

Direct Sowing Period

For direct sowing of Agastache seeds, it is best to wait until the risk of frost has passed.

Sowing Period Under Cover

The ideal time to sow Agastache seeds under cover is from March to May. During this period, the plant can develop steadily before being transplanted to its permanent spot in the garden.

Planting Time

The best time to plant Agastache is in May. This timing gives the plant a chance to establish well and grow before the onset of summer heat.

Seedling Care

Provide regular watering especially during dry spells to support healthy growth and abundant flowering. Remove spent flowers to encourage prolonged blooming.

Plant Spacing

To ensure proper development, a spacing of 20x30 cm is recommended. This allows the plants ample room to grow and make the most of the soil's potential.

Companion Planting

Agastache blends beautifully with other ornamental plants such as lavender, sage, and coneflower. These combinations create a harmonious display of colours and fragrances, attracting numerous pollinating insects.

Site Conditions

Mexican Giant Hyssop prefers sunny or slightly shaded spots. The soil should be well-drained with moderate moisture. This plant does not require heavy fertilisation, but regular watering, particularly during droughts, is advisable to ensure its healthy growth and abundant flowering.

Growing Tips

Agastache is a relatively low-maintenance plant. Regularly deadhead flowers to promote longer blooming. During intense growth periods, a light application of organic fertiliser can strengthen its structure.

Plant Height

Mexican Giant Hyssop reaches a height of 60-80 cm, making it an excellent choice for mid-border plantings, where it will complement other plants of similar height beautifully.

Flowering Period

Agastache flowers from July to October, making it one of the longest-blooming residents of the garden. Its presence can be enjoyed throughout summer and into early autumn.

Usage

Agastache is a versatile plant. It works well in flower beds, as part of wildflower meadows, or as a decorative element on balconies and terraces in the form of cut flowers. Its aromatic leaves can also be used in potpourri or as a natural insect repellent.

Resistance to Diseases

Agastache is known for its strong resistance to most plant diseases, making it an ideal choice for gardeners who value ease of care. Maintaining optimal soil and lighting conditions minimises the risk of health issues.

Good to Know

Agastache not only pleases the eye but also supports biodiversity in the garden by attracting many pollinating insects. Its leaves can be used as an addition to herbal teas, enriching their flavour with mint and anise notes. Additionally, Agastache is a nectar-rich plant, which is especially beneficial for bees and other pollinators.
